Substantial Autonomy
Describes a significant level of independence or self-direction that an individual or unit has to make decisions.
Communities of Practice
Groups of people who share a concern, a set of problems, or a passion about a topic, and who deepen their knowledge and expertise in this area by interacting on an ongoing basis.
Virtual Teams
Groups of individuals who work together from different geographical locations and rely on communication technologies to collaborate.
Cross-Functional
Cross-functional refers to a situation or project involving members from different departments or areas of expertise within an organization working together.
